Free Shipping!In StockRx RequiredAbsorbable Suture with Needle PDS II Polydioxanone CP-1 1/2 Circle Reverse Cutting Needle Size 2 - 0 Monofilament, 36 per Box
PDS II absorbable suture with needle is a monofilament polydioxanone suture paired with a CP-1 1/2 circle reverse cutting needle. It fits buyers looking for a long-lasting synthetic absorbable option with easier handling, smooth tissue passage, and low tissue reactivity. This version has a size 2-0 violet suture, a 27 inch strand, and a 36 mm stainless steel needle.

Key Features
- Long-lasting synthetic absorbable suture for procedures that need extended strength retention
- Monofilament polydioxanone construction supports smooth passage through tissue
- Greater pliability and easier handling can help support suturing workflow
- Reverse cutting needle with 1/2 circle shape suits controlled needle placement
- Retains 80% strength at 2 weeks, 70% at 4 weeks, and 60% at 6 weeks
- Complete mass absorption occurs in 183 to 238 days

FAQ
- How long does this suture retain strength? PDS II retains 80% strength at 2 weeks, 70% at 4 weeks, and 60% at 6 weeks.
- How long does absorption take? Complete mass absorption occurs in 183 to 238 days.
- What needle style comes with this suture? This suture comes with one CP-1 reverse cutting needle in a 1/2 circle shape. The needle length is 36 mm.
- What are the suture material and construction? The suture is made of polydioxanone and uses a monofilament construction.
- What size and length is the suture? This SKU is size 2-0 and the suture length is 27 inch.
